Medical Receptionist and Scheduler

Overview
Join our dynamic healthcare team as a Medical Receptionist and Scheduler, where your energetic and organized approach will be vital in creating a welcoming environment for patients and supporting smooth clinic operations. In this role, you will serve as the first point of contact, managing patient intake, appointment scheduling, and administrative support with enthusiasm and professionalism. Your expertise in medical office systems and commitment to excellent patient service will help ensure efficient clinic workflows and positive patient experiences.

We are looking for the right team member who supports our mission, loves our Patients and our team and loves helping people. Someone willing to learn and grow and improve daily.

Duties

  • Greet patients warmly upon arrival, ensuring a positive first impression and providing exceptional customer service.
  • Schedule appointments accurately using EMR (Electronic Medical Records) systems such as Prompt EMR while managing calendar availability effectively.
  • Verify insurance coverage, perform insurance eligibility checks, and handle insurance verification processes to facilitate seamless billing.
  • Collect and process patient information, update medical records, and review documentation for accuracy in compliance with HIPAA regulations.
  • Assist with medical billing and collections by coding procedures with CPT (Current Procedural Terminology) codes and ICD (International Classification of Diseases) codes such as ICD-9/ICD-10.
  • Manage multi-line phone systems with professional phone etiquette, addressing patient inquiries promptly and directing calls appropriately.
  • Maintain organized filing of medical records, handle data entry tasks including 10-key typing, and ensure all documentation aligns with health information management standards.
  • Support clinic operations by reviewing care plans, assisting with intake procedures, and coordinating appointment follow-ups.
  • Utilize office management software such as Microsoft Office.
  • Collect co pays.
  • Uphold confidentiality standards by adhering to HIPAA guidelines during all patient interactions and documentation review processes.
